Harnessing AI to Activate Inactive Database Segments

AI plays a significant role in revitalizing dormant segments within a database. By utilizing advanced algorithms and machine learning, it can sift through large sets of historical data to pinpoint individuals who have previously engaged but are no longer active.

Through predictive analysis, AI evaluates patterns from past interactions. This allows businesses to identify which segments may respond positively to specific marketing strategies or products.

By focusing on the right segments, companies can tailor their messaging effectively, increasing the likelihood of re-engagement.

Moreover, AI facilitates the creation of personalized outreach campaigns. It enables the automation of messages that feel unique to each recipient, enhancing the chances that they will reconnect with the brand. Instead of using broad messaging, businesses can fine-tune their communications based on insights derived from AI.

Feedback loops can also be enhanced with AI’s capabilities. When a campaign is launched, AI tools can track responses and engagement levels. This real-time data allows for quick adjustments to strategies, ensuring ongoing improvement in reaching out to inactive users.

The integration of AI in targeting dormant segments can transform a business’s reactivation efforts.

By carefully analyzing data and optimizing outreach methods, companies become more effective in drawing back leads that might otherwise remain inactive.

Strategies for Effective Database Cleaning and Enrichment

To maintain a robust database, regular cleaning and enrichment are essential steps. Start by verifying the accuracy of the information. Implement automated tools that can flag duplicates and incorrect entries. Regular scheduled audits help identify outdated information, which can be flagged for review or removal.

Regular maintenance of a database is vital for its effectiveness. The following table outlines essential steps for cleaning and enriching data.

Step Description Frequency Tools
Data Verification Check the accuracy of information stored in the database. Ongoing Manual checks, Verification software
Duplicate Detection Use tools to identify and flag duplicate entries. Monthly Automated tools
Outdated Information Review Regular audits to find and review outdated information. Quarterly Audit software
Data Enrichment Enhance existing data with additional relevant information. As needed Data enrichment services
Removal of Incorrect Entries Flag and remove data that is inaccurate or irrelevant. As required Database management tools

Enrichment involves supplementing existing data with additional details. This can include demographic information or updated contact details. Using third-party data providers can greatly aid in this process. Look for reliable sources that offer the latest insights, ensuring you have a well-rounded view of customer profiles.

Another strategy is to segment your database. By organizing contacts based on shared characteristics or past behavior, you can ensure that communications are targeted and relevant. This tailored approach increases engagement, making your messages more impactful.

Analyzing Data Quality for Effective Database Reactivation

Ensuring the quality of data is essential for effective database reactivation. If the information stored is inaccurate, outdated, or irrelevant, outreach efforts may fall flat. To start, businesses must regularly check the accuracy of their records. This means confirming that names, email addresses, and other contact details are current.

If a customer has changed their email or phone number, reaching them could be impossible.

Cleaning the database involves removing duplicate entries. When the same person is listed multiple times, it can lead to confusion and miscommunication. It is important to use automated tools that can spot and flag these duplicates quickly, making the data easier to manage.

Another key aspect is identifying outdated information. Scheduled audits help in reviewing data to find contacts that havent engaged in a long time. Such contacts might need a fresh approach or even be removed if they no longer fit the target audience. This review process aids businesses in refining their focus on leads most likely to convert.

Enrichment of existing data is also vital. By adding new information, businesses can create a more comprehensive profile of their customers. This can include demographic information or insights from customer interactions. Third-party data providers might assist in delivering this required information, allowing for more informed outreach strategies.
